    3. Consider the Size and Height of the Rooms

    The size of your chandelier should be proportional to the size of the room. Here are some basic rules:

    • Large rooms (living room, dining room) : Choose imposing chandeliers that attract the eye.
    • Small rooms (bedrooms, offices) : Opt for more discreet but equally elegant models.
    • Ceiling height : In rooms with high ceilings, choose chandeliers with adjustable chains for optimal positioning.

    4. Choose the Right Light Intensity

    Lighting should be both functional and decorative. Consider the following points:

    • General lighting : A chandelier should provide enough light to illuminate the entire room.
    • Mood lighting : For a softer atmosphere, choose dimmable bulbs or combine your chandelier with other light sources such as wall sconces.

    5. Materials and Finishes

    The materials and finishes of your chandelier should complement the rest of your decor:

    • Crystal : For a touch of luxury and elegance.
    • Glass : Ideal for a modern and refined style.
    • Metal : Gold, silver, bronze, or wrought iron finishes can suit different styles, from classic to contemporary.
    • Wood : Perfect for a rustic or natural look.

    6. Installation and Maintenance

    Safety and maintenance are crucial aspects:

    • Installation : Hire a professional to install your chandelier, especially if it is heavy or complex.
    • Maintenance : Crystal and glass chandeliers require regular cleaning to maintain their shine. Materials such as metal or wood may require special care to prevent rust or tarnishing.

    7. Trend and Innovation

    Modern chandeliers often incorporate innovative technologies:

    • LED : For energy efficiency and long life.
    • Remote controls and dimmers : To adjust the light intensity according to your needs.
    • Modular designs : Some chandeliers allow you to change their configuration to adapt to different moods.
